Universal (NYSE:UVV) Stock Price Down 4.6% - Here's Why

Universal logo with Consumer Staples background

Universal Co. (NYSE:UVV - Get Free Report)'s stock price traded down 4.6% during mid-day trading on Tuesday . The company traded as low as $62.27 and last traded at $62.27. 67,970 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 58% from the average session volume of 160,264 shares. The stock had previously closed at $65.30.

Universal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, August 4th. Investors of record on Monday, July 14th will be paid a $0.82 dividend. This is a boost from Universal's previous quarterly dividend of $0.81.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, July 14th. This represents a $3.28 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 5.42%. Universal's payout ratio is 86.77%.

Universal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Universal Corporation processes and supplies leaf tobacco and plant-based ingredients worldwide. The company operates through two segments, Tobacco Operations; and Ingredients Operations. It is involved in the procuring, financing, processing, packing, storing, and shipping leaf tobacco for sale to manufacturers of consumer tobacco products.
